**Ticket: Drift detected in Almsgather receipt mailer config**

The nightly audit flagged that the donation-receipt mailer in production has diverged from what's in the repo. Retry intervals, batch sizes, and the template cache TTL were all changed manually during the March incident and never backported. This ticket tracks reconciling the two. For review purposes, the values currently live in production are listed below.

settings of fafog-haduf:
ZORIX_PIN=4648
ZORIX_METRICS_HOST=metrics.zorix.paliqsys.corp
ZORIX_LOG_LEVEL=info
ZORIX_TENANT=druix

Environments: Ledgerline Payments

Quick note on retries: every environment enforces idempotency keys, so replays never double-charge. Staging uses a shorter key TTL than prod, which trips people up when testing slow retries. Sandbox accepts any key format; prod validates strictly. Here's what each environment currently runs with.

service settings:
WENATH_PIN=5007
WENATH_METRICS_HOST=metrics.wenath.tolvaqlabs.corp
WENATH_LOG_LEVEL=debug
WENATH_TENANT=rusox

Effective immediately for Veltrix Systems deals above tier-three volume: standard discount cap is 18%. Anything above requires sign-off from the regional finance lead. No stacking with the Orvane launch promotion. Multi-year commitments may add 4% per contracted year, capped at 26% total. Log every exception in the approvals tracker within 48 hours. Discounts on the Kestrel add-on remain frozen pending margin review. Finance will audit Q3 deals monthly. The rationale for the cap sits in the note below.

internal memo for bahap-yagug: Headcount on the Ulaix team goes from 3 to 100 by the end of January. Gross margin on Ulaix came in at 10 percent against a plan of 15 percent.